About Theunis Avenant

Theunis Avenant is a scholar working on Infectious Diseases, Emergency Medicine and Virology, having authored 31 papers that have together received 524 indexed citations. Recurring topics across this work include Pneumonia and Respiratory Infections (8 papers), Respiratory viral infections research (5 papers), HIV/AIDS Research and Interventions (5 papers), Viral gastroenteritis research and epidemiology (4 papers), Pneumocystis jirovecii pneumonia detection and treatment (4 papers), HIV/AIDS drug development and treatment (4 papers), HIV Research and Treatment (3 papers) and Antifungal resistance and susceptibility (3 papers). The work is most often cited by research in Infectious Diseases (325 citations), Virology (58 citations) and Epidemiology (233 citations). Theunis Avenant has collaborated with scholars based in South Africa, United States and Australia. Frequent co-authors include Nicolette du Plessis, Janet Mans, Maureen B. Taylor, Nelesh P. Govender, Angeliki Messina, Juno Thomas, Erika van Schalkwyk, Chetna Govind, Vindana Chibabhai and Gary Reubenson.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and PEDIATRICS.
